B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ION
The present invention relates to a new and improved display apparatus and more specifically to a display apparatus having a solid state light-emitting element which provides light transmitted to a viewer.
Many different known types of display apparatus have utilized solid state light emitting elements, such as light emitting diodes, as light sources. These solid state light emitting elements (LEDs) have previously been surface mounted with a major side surface of the light emitting element facing toward a base. This results in the base blocking the transmittal of light from one side of the solid state light-emitting element to a viewer.
SUMMARY OF THE INVENTION
The present invention relates to a new and improved display apparatus having solid state light emitting element as a source of light. The solid state light emitting element is mounted on a base with opposite major sides of the solid state light emitting element exposed. This enables light to be transmitted from opposite sides of the solid state light-emitting element to a viewer. A housing of the display apparatus includes a base on which the solid state light emitting element is supported in an on-edge orientation by a pair of support pins.
A display section of the housing may contain a recess in which the solid state light emitting element and, if desired, a filter assembly, are disposed. Light transmitted from opposite major side surfaces of the solid state light emitting element is conducted through transparent material of the display section to a translucent display surface.
